30 % des personnes jouant aux jeux vidéos aiment Coldplay

30 % des personnes jouant aux jeux vidéos aiment Coldplay
Une étude a été faite par IGN Entertainment's GamerMetrics and Research Solutions en mars 2006, elle vise à étudier la personnalité et les goûts des personnes jouant aux jeux vidéos.

Cette enquête a montré que leurs principaux goûts musicaux gravitent autour des grands groupes de pop rock actuels tels que Gorillaz, U2, Radiohead... (voir photo ci contre pour le classement).

Coldplay est n° 5 avec 30 %.

UCLA's "A taste of Napa" Evening du 20/05/2006

UCLA's "A taste of Napa" Evening du 20/05/2006
Chris Martin accompagné de Jonny Buckland se sont produits hier soir pour un dîner au profit de le recherche contre le cancer au Regent Wilshire à Beverly Hills en Californie (USA).

Tous les ans, un repas au bénéfice de la recherche contre le cancer (Jonsson Center Foundation) à lieu à la UCLA. Cette année le thème du repas était "Napa Valley" et des grands chefs cuisiniers du monde entier sont venus préseter et faire déguster des repas extravagants.

Cette action vise à trouver des fonds privés pour la recherche contre le cancer, supporter les recherches en laboratoires des scientifiques afin de trouver des thérapies efficaces pour les patients atteints du cancer.

Voici le contenu de cette interview

“The CD contains 85 speech cuts, featuring all four members of Coldplay. The interview was conducted in London on May 24th 2002 by Danny O'Connor. Before each cut, you are given a suggested form of words for your question, so you can set it up."

Cuts 01-14 are with Guy
Cuts 15-27 are with Will
Cuts 28-46 are with Jonny
Cuts 47-61 are with Chris
Cuts 62-72 deal directly with the music on A Rush of Blood to the Head, track by track
Cuts 73-85 are I.D.s for band members; and I.D.s for all the album tracks
